   <title>OPAL Fuels and GFL Environmental advance RNG projects in Alabama, Georgia</title>
   <link>http://www.streetinsider.com/Corporate+News/OPAL+Fuels+and+GFL+Environmental+advance+RNG+projects+in+Alabama%2C+Georgia/26595022.html</link>
   <description>&lt;p&gt;OPAL Fuels Inc. (NASDAQ: OPAL) and GFL Environmental Inc. (NYSE: GFL) announced the advancement of construction for two renewable natural gas facilities at landfills in Alabama and Georgia, according to a press release statement.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;The projects are located at the Stones Throw Landfill in Tallapoosa County, Alabama and the Grady Road Landfill in Polk County, Georgia. The facilities represent nearly 2 million MMBTU of plant design capacity and are owned equally by both companies at 50 percent each.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;The new RNG facilities are expected to add approximately 15 million gasoline gallon equivalents of RNG supply capacity.
